The scalable process topology interface of MPI 2.2

نویسندگان

  • Torsten Hoefler
  • Rolf Rabenseifner
  • Hubert Ritzdorf
  • Bronis R. de Supinski
  • Rajeev Thakur
  • Jesper Larsson Träff
چکیده

1 University of Illinois at Urbana-Champaign, 1205 W. Clark St. Urbana, IL 61801, USA 2 HLRS, University of Stuttgart, D-70550 Stuttgart, Germany 3 HPCE, NEC Deutschland GmbH, Hansaallee 101, 40549 Düsseldorf, Germany 4 Lawrence Livermore National Laboratory, Box 808, L-557, Livermore, CA 94551-0808 5 Mathematics and Computer Science Division, Argonne National Laboratory, 9700 S. Cass Avenue, Argonne, IL 60439 6 Department of Scientific Computing, University of Vienna, Nordbergstrasse 15/3C, A-1090 Vienna, Austria

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A Scalable InfiniBand Network Topology-Aware Performance Analysis Tool for MPI

Over the last decade, InfiniBand (IB) has become an increasingly popular interconnect for deploying modern supercomputing systems. As supercomputing systems grow in size and scale, the impact of IB network topology on the performance of high performance computing (HPC) applications also increase. Depending on the kind of network (FAT Tree, Tori, or Mesh), the number of network hops involved in ...

متن کامل

MPI++: Issues and Features

The draft of the MPI (Message-Passing Interface) standard was released at Supercomputing '93, November 1993. The nal MPI document is expected to be released in mid-April of 1994. Language bindings for C and FORTRANwere included in the draft; however, a language binding for C++ was not included. MPI provides support for datatypes and topologies that is needed for developing numerical libraries, ...

متن کامل

Efficient MPI Support for Advanced Hybrid Programming Models

The number of multithreaded Message Passing Interface (MPI) implementations and applications is increasing rapidly. We discuss how multithreaded applications can receive messages of unknown size. As is well known, combining MPI Probe/MPI Recv is not threadsafe, but many assume that trivial workarounds exist. We discuss those workarounds and show how they fail in practice by either limiting the ...

متن کامل

Concepts for Integrating SISCI into Open-MPI

Since version 2 of the Message Passing Interface (MPI) the MPI job has the ability to start new processes dynamically at runtime. The MPI implementation has to care for the creation of new communication channels in those situations. This work desribes the implications of dynamic process creation on an communication module for the Scalable Coherent Interface (SCI). The module is developed for th...

متن کامل

A Scalable Non-blocking Multicast Scheme for Distributed DAG Scheduling

This paper presents an application-level non-blocking multicast scheme for dynamic DAG scheduling on large-scale distributedmemory systems. The multicast scheme takes into account both network topology and space requirement of routing tables to achieve scalability. Specifically, we prove that the scheme is deadlock-free and takes at most logN steps to complete. The routing table chooses appropr...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• Concurrency and Computation: Practice and Experience

دوره 23  شماره 

صفحات  -

تاریخ انتشار 2011